The home loan process: A step-by-step guide
- Work out what you can afford: look at your income, deposit, and repayments.
- Compare lenders or use a broker: shop around for the best rates and terms.
- Get your finances in shape: tuck your savings away, reduce debt, and have bank statements ready.
- Pull together your deposit: aim for 20%, or check if you qualify for KiwiSaver or first-home buyer support.
- Apply and get approved: secure conditional approval, make an offer, then finalise with your lawyer at settlement.
